Output dd3acc264e5328bfc3032b5bd3d2f8a22359c1e75a97d757589948b1f24f3f73:1

value
1365947
script pubkey
OP_0 OP_PUSHBYTES_20 f3c15be2a16ec6a5c50dec3c1698d630ca771900
address
bc1q70q4hc4pdmr2t3gdas7pdxxkxr98wxgqcgl7uu
transaction
dd3acc264e5328bfc3032b5bd3d2f8a22359c1e75a97d757589948b1f24f3f73
spent
true